Joan B. Retzler, age 81, of Unionville, passed away November 4, 2016, at Bay Medical Care Facility in Esssexville.
Joan was born October 21, 1935, in Bay City, the daughter of the late Roland and Bernice (Lapan) Knight. She married Richard Retzler on May 12, 1956 in Sebewaing. She worked as a cook at many local restaurants and was a cook at USA Schools for a little over four years. She enjoyed cooking, baking, golfing, shooting pool, watching cooking shows and QVC, going on casino trips and visiting the cabin in Tawas. Joan was a member of Our Lady of Consolata Catholic Church (Holy Family) in Sebewaing and was a member of the Holy Family Women's Circle. She adored her spending time with her children and grandchildren.
